- Do skylights leak?
- Properly installed Velux skylights with factory flashing kits do not leak. Most leaks come from improper installation. We back every install with a 10-year leak-free guarantee.
- Can I get a tax credit for a solar skylight?
- Yes — Velux Solar-Powered Fresh-Air skylights and Sun Tunnels qualify for a 30% federal tax credit through 2032.
- How much does skylight installation cost?
- Standard fixed skylights typically install for $1,800–$3,000. Solar-powered fresh-air skylights run $2,500–$4,500 before tax credits.
- Should I replace my skylight when I replace my roof?
- Absolutely. Skylight life is similar to roof life and the labor is partly overlap — replacing both at once saves significantly.
